Hey there L&C....

This sort of thing happened to me many times during my recovery...was it a retear...who knows really. My guess is that it could be a small new tear if it does not hurt too much, may simply be a bit of aggravation of your sensitive scar tissue which might bleed...or like me you might have a papilla that has grown a bit and that can get aggravated and bleed a bit. My papilla will bleed a tiny bit if I have a harder movement....but goes away quickly and does not compare to the pain or discomfort of a fissure.

If you are not in much pain I wouldn't sweat it too much....keep up any good eating, drinking and other habits that generally help fissures and you should be good.
